A/C Hose, Evaporator Installation and Repair Tips for 2000 Jeep Cherokee

  • Q:
    How is the Evaporator Core Serviced and Repaired on 2000 Jeep Cherokee?
    A:
    To service the evaporator core, make sure safety precautions that apply to airbag-equipped vehicles. Remove the Heater-A/C housing, and lift out the evaporator coil. To install, reverse the steps, being careful to reinstall the foam insulator and rubber seal. If replaced, put 60 milliliters of recommended refrigerant oil.
  • Q:
    How to Replace an A/C Hose Without Compromising System Capacity on 2000 Jeep Cherokee?
    A:
    In order to install the A/C discharge hose, make sure that there are no kinks in the refrigerant lines as well as that the bend radius is ten times greater than hose diameter. De-commission battery, recover refrigerant and unplug high pressure switch. Eliminate and install the discharge line and reconnect all the parts and fill the refrigerant system.
